WebSICPs are the basic infection prevention and control measures necessary to reduce the risk of transmission of infectious agent, from both recognised and unrecognised sources of infection. Sources of (potential) infection include blood and other body fluids secretions or excretions (excluding sweat), non-intact skin or mucous membranes and any ... WebStandard infection control precautions are the basic minimum standard of hygiene to be applied throughout all contact with blood and body fluids from any source to control the spread of infection within clinical practice. Standard infection control precautions comprise the following elements: Assessment of the risk to and from individuals.
